Kotwara House is owned by Muzzaffar and Meera Ali. Muzzaffar is an Indian filmmaker, fashion designer, poet and artist. He belongs to the Muslin Rajput royal house of Kotwara and is the current Raja of Kotwara. His wife, Meera Ali is an architect and fashion designer. They have created an international couture label, “The House of Kotwara”. On this tour, you will see their workshop for their label and interact with highly skilled artisans. Clips from Muzaffer’s classic films are shown as you have a cup of tea/coffee.

Curated Dining At Kotwara House

In this evening tour, enjoy a curated dining experience at Kotwara House, the residence of one of the oldest royal families of Awadh. Situated in the posh Qaiser Bagh area of Lucknow, this royal residence of the present Raja Muzaffar Ali is a living museum of art and craft. Essentially a painter, poet and film-maker, Muzaffar Ali is known for his classic film Umrao Jaan. Enjoy a meal specially curated by Muzaffar Ali and his wife Meera Ali.

Private Walking Tour of Kaiserbagh Palace Complex

This is a private two hour walking tour of the Kaiserbagh Palace complex. This historic Palace is considered one of India’s beautiful royal buildings. It was planned and built by the Rajput ruler, Wajid-Ali-Shah in the mid 1800s. Your tour will also take you to the Kotwara House, now the home of famous Indian filmmaker, Muzaffar Ali.
